Magellan Launches 7-Inch RoadMate 1700 GPS Navigation System
Coated — ... AAA TourBook guide travel information to help users make the most of their road trips. If you already know where to go, the RoadMate 1700 can hook up to iPods and other video source to show movies on the 7-inch screen, keeping passengers (and only passengers!) entertained. Magellan’s new GPS system will cost $299 and will come with all the necessary tools for mounting and charging on the go. Other accessories such as cases and pouches can also be bought separately.
